No stamping for a change here. I decided to create a bouquet by scoring and folding a square of paper. The red represents the poppy for Remembrance Day, the flowers because my Grandma loved flowers, and so do I, and roses because her name was Rose. I punched some flowers and ferns and used an assortment from my stash, added some gems and a silver ribbon.
